Usual Faults


Typical dish washer mistakes could range from small to significant ones. Depending on the extent, you will either require the solutions of professional plumbing technicians to deal with or change it.
Some of the most typical faults consist of:

Dripping Dishwasher


This is most likely one of the most everyday dishwashing machine trouble, and fortunately is that it is very easy to recognize. Leaks happen as a result of several reasons, as well as the leakages can ruin your kitchen. Typical root causes of dish washer leaks include;
  • Incorrect pipeline link: If the pipes at the back of your device are not firmly dealt with or if they are worn out, it can cause leaks.

  • Incorrect recipe piling: Always guarantee that you do not overstack the tray and that you set up the recipes effectively

  • Way too much detergent: Putting more than enough detergent might additionally create a leakage. Make certain that you put just enough for your dishes and also not more.

  • Rust: It could also be a result of some rust or rust of your device. In this situation, it is much better to change the dishwashing machine.

  • Door Seals: Inspect if the door seals are still undamaged and securely fastened. If the seals are not in position, it could be a considerable root cause of leakages.

  • Does unclean correctly

  • If your meals as well as cutleries come out of the dishwasher and also still look filthy or unclean, your spray arms may be an issue. Oftentimes, the spray arms can get clogged, and also it will certainly call for a fast tidy or a replacement to work efficiently again.

    Inability to Drain pipes


    Occasionally you might observe a big amount of water left in your tub after a wash. That is probably a water drainage trouble. You can either inspect the drain hose pipe for damages or clogs. When doubtful, call an expert to have it checked and taken care of.
  • Bad-Smelling Dish washer

  • This is an additional typical dishwashing machine problem, and also it is mostly triggered by food debris or oil lingering in the equipment. In this situation, look for these fragments, take them out as well as do the dishes with no dishes inside the maker. Wash the filter extensively. That will aid do away with the bad odor. Ensure that you get rid of every food particle from your recipes before moving it to the device in the future.

    8 Most Common Dishwasher Problems & How to Fix Them


    My Dishwasher Isn't Draining


    If your dishwasher isn't draining properly, you may be having an issue with your dishwasher's drainage system. This can be caused by a variety of issues:


  • Clogged drain: The dishwasher's drain may be clogged with food particles or other debris.


  • Malfunctioning pump: The dishwasher's pump is responsible for moving water through the system and out of the drain. If it's damaged or not working correctly, it could cause a drainage failure.


  • Broken or clogged hose: The dishwasher's drain hose may be broken or clogged, causing water to back up in the system.


  • How to Fix Dishwasher Not Draining


  • Check the drain for any blockages. A clogged or kinked hose will prevent water from properly draining out of the dishwasher. Use a plunger or a pipe snake to clear any debris that may be blocking the drain.


  • Check the dishwasher's pump for damage or malfunction. Consult the manufacturer's manual or call a professional appliance repair service if you think the pump may be the issue.


  • Check the drain hose for any damage or blockages. The hose should be straight and free of any debris or kinks.


  • Check the drain pump filters for any blockages if the hose is clear, but the dishwasher is still not draining. Some dishwashers have filters that can become clogged with food particles or debris. Cleaning or replacing the filters may help resolve the issue. Run a dishwasher cycle to make sure the water is properly draining out.


  • My Dishwasher Is Leaking


    A leaking dishwasher can be frustrating. There are a few possible causes that you can investigate to try and diagnose the issue:


  • Inspect the dishwasher for any visible signs of damage or wear and tear. Look for cracks or holes in the door and around the rubber seal.


  • Check the hoses and pipes connected to the dishwasher for any signs of leaking. If there is no visible damage, you may hear the sound of water dripping or the sound of the water pump running. This might mean a problem with the water inlet valve or the drain pump.


  • You may also notice a puddle of water on the floor near the dishwasher. This could indicate a blocked drain hose or a faulty drain pump.


  • Finally, check the seals around the door and the door for any signs of damage, wear and tear, or improper installation. If any of these issues are present, they must be fixed immediately to avoid further water damage.


  • How to Fix a Leaky Dishwasher


  • Identify where the leak is coming from. The most common places for a dishwasher to leak include the door, hoses, and pump.


  • If the leak is coming from the door, the gasket or seal may need to be replaced. If the leak is from the hose or pump, the damaged parts should be replaced with new ones.


  • Finally, check all the connections and make sure they are secure and not leaking
